Here is a poem contributed by one of our teleclass participants—an awareness that came to her after a time of great turmoil.
In my mind (Karen) it speaks to the deeper, softer place that is available to us always. Unfortunately we often contact it through the doorway of pain instead of consciously developing the contact. The task seems to be to create a stronger connection to this place that holds our soul’s presence, and allow more space for it to take up resonance in our lives.

at peace
with my world
in spite of the way
things have been
with hope
for the future
no weight on
my feet
in the midst
of the sadness
tears turned
to cooling rain
restful
not so restless
at peace
again
